Freaky Frogs from Outaspace is a standout card game that captures the thrilling essence of pinball, making it perfect for players who enjoy solo challenges. Released on July 5, 2025, by Rio Grande Games, this game designed by Friedemann Friese lets you experience the excitement of a pinball session right at your table. Your goal? Keep the ball running on the pinball machine while aiming for a new high score. The game allows for multiball starts and extra ball achievements, adding layers of strategy to the gameplay. Weighing only 9.2 ounces and measuring 14.75 x 10.75 x 2.25 inches, it's easy to set up. With a perfect 5.0-star rating, it's definitely worth trying if you're a pinball enthusiast! Age Appropriateness

While considering age appropriateness in choosing a pinball player, it's important to recognize that most pinball games are designed for children aged 6 and older. This means they're perfect for family settings, allowing younger players to jump in and enjoy the fun. I've seen how games can enhance hand-eye coordination and strategic thinking, particularly appealing to kids aged 6 to 15.

When you're choosing a pinball game for younger players, look for those emphasizing cooperative or competitive play. These games create great opportunities for social interaction among friends and family, making the experience even more enjoyable. Additionally, age-appropriate designs often feature simplified controls and engaging themes that keep kids entertained while they learn.

However, I can't stress enough the importance of safety. Some pinball machines may have small parts that can pose choking hazards for children under 3 years old. Always check the safety warnings before introducing a game to younger audiences. By keeping these factors in mind, you'll guarantee that the pinball experience is not just fun but also safe and beneficial for younger players.

Maintenance Requirements

Investing in a pinball machine isn't just about the price and features; maintenance requirements also play a significant role in the decision-making process. I've learned that most electronic models typically need regular battery replacements, often requiring 3 AA batteries. It's a small detail that can easily be overlooked but can affect gameplay.

I also pay attention to whether the machine needs minor assembly and periodic checks. Confirming that moving parts, like bumpers and flippers, function smoothly is essential to avoiding interruptions during play. A machine designed to prevent ball jams is invaluable, as troubleshooting and clearing stuck balls can be a hassle.

When I shop for a pinball machine, I look for models with easy access to internal components. This feature makes cleaning and maintenance a breeze, ultimately extending the game's lifespan. Finally, I always check if the manufacturer provides warranty support. This can be a lifesaver for addressing any issues that crop up during regular use. By considering these maintenance requirements, I guarantee that my investment brings joy for years to come, rather than becoming a source of frustration.
